Factors Affecting HVAC Installment CostsUnderstanding the variables that impact HVAC installment costs will certainly aid you plan your budget plan better. Right here are some vital elements to consider:
1. Dimension and Complexity of the SystemThe size and complexity of your cooling and heating system straight influence the installment prices. Larger systems or those with additional components such as humidifiers or air cleansers might require more labor and products, causing greater expenses.
2. Type of SystemDifferent sorts of HVAC systems have differing installment prices. For example, central air systems generally cost even more to mount than home window units. In a similar way, geothermal heat pumps may have higher upfront prices yet use long-lasting power savings.
3. Ductwork RequirementsIf your home does not have existing ductwork or requires adjustments to fit the brand-new system, added costs may be sustained for ductwork setup or modifications.
4. Energy Performance RatingsOpting for high-efficiency heating and cooling devices might result in higher ahead of time prices however can cause considerable energy financial savings over time. Consider the long-lasting advantages when budgeting for installation.

Budgeting Tips for HVAC InstallationNow that we have a much better understanding of the elements affecting cooling and heating installation costs allow's explore some budgeting tips to aid you intend successfully:
1. Research and Get Numerous QuotesResearch different heating and cooling specialists in your location and request several quotes for installation. This will certainly provide you a better concept of the average expense array and help you select the most competitive option.
2. Take Into Consideration Long-Term SavingsWhile it might be tempting to select the cheapest upfront price, consider the long-term financial savings offered by energy-efficient systems. High-efficiency equipment might have higher initial expenses yet can result in considerable power cost savings over time.
3. Strategy AheadIf feasible, plan your HVAC installment throughout off-peak seasons when professionals may offer discounts or promos. Stay clear of waiting up until an emergency scenario emerges, as it may restrict your options and cause higher costs.
4. Check Out Financing OptionsIf the in advance cost of HVAC installment is past your budget, explore financing choices provided by cooling and heating firms or financial institutions. This will certainly permit you to spread out the costs in time while still appreciating a comfortable interior environment.
5. Benefit From Rebates and IncentivesCheck if there are any kind of rebates or motivations offered for installing energy-efficient a/c systems in your location. These can help offset some of the ahead of time costs and supply extra cost savings in the lengthy run.
6. Do Not Cut Corners on Specialist InstallationWhile it might be alluring to try DIY cooling and heating setup to conserve cash, it is highly advised to employ an expert. Inappropriate setup can bring about costly repair services and reduced system efficiency, negating any type of prospective savings.
Frequently Asked Concerns (FAQs)Q: How much does HVAC installation typically cost? A: The expense of HVAC setup can vary extensively depending upon factors such as system size, intricacy, kind, and extra services needed. On average, home owners can expect to invest between $3,000 and $7,000 for a complete installation.
Q: Are there any kind of tax credits available for HVAC installation? A: Yes, there are frequently government or neighborhood tax obligation credit scores readily available for mounting energy-efficient heating and cooling systems. Consult your regional tax obligation authority or speak with an a/c professional to determine if you get approved for any credits.
Q: Do I require to replace my ductwork during HVAC setup? A: It depends on the problem of your existing ductwork. If it remains in good condition and correctly sized for the new system, there might be no requirement for replacement. Nonetheless, if your ductwork is old or damaged, changing it may be needed for optimum system performance.
Q: How long does heating and cooling installation typically take? A: The period of HVAC setup can vary depending upon variables such as the intricacy of the system and any type of additional services called for. Typically, a total installation may take anywhere from one to five days.
